当前位置:首页 > 行业动态 > 正文

php显示mysql数据库中的数据库_Mysql数据库

要使用PHP显示MySQL数据库中的数据,首先确保已安装MySQL和 PHP环境。编写PHP脚本来连接MySQL 数据库,执行查询语句,并处理返回的结果集以在网页上显示数据。

在现代Web开发中,PHP与MySQL数据库的集成使用是一项基础且关键的技术组合,PHP是一种功能强大的服务器端脚本语言,而MySQL是一个广泛应用在全球的开源关系型数据库管理系统,这种组合不仅能够提高网站的数据动态性和交互性,还能有效处理大量数据存储和快速检索问题,具体分析如下:

php显示mysql数据库中的数据库_Mysql数据库  第1张

1、PHP与MySQL的集成

连接MySQL:PHP 5及以上版本推荐使用MySQLi扩展或PDO(PHP Data Objects)来连接MySQL,这两种方式都提供了面向对象的接口,使得PHP与MySQL数据库的交互更加高效安全。

选择数据库:连接数据库后,需要选择一个数据库进行操作,使用mysqli_select_db()或PDO的exec()方法可以选择合适的数据库。

执行查询:利用mysqli_query()或PDO的execute()方法,可以执行SQL查询,获取数据库中的表或数据。

2、显示数据库中的表

获取表名:通过执行“SHOW TABLES”SQL命令,可以获得数据库中所有表的列表。

显示表数据:对于每个表,执行“SELECT * FROM 表名”可以获取表中所有数据,PHP可以将查询结果显示在HTML表格中,便于查看和管理。

3、管理数据库

创建和删除表:通过PHP脚本执行CREATE TABLE或DROP TABLE的SQL语句,可以方便地创建新表或删除现有表。

数据的增删改查:PHP可以执行INSERT、UPDATE、DELETE等SQL语句,实现数据的增加、修改和删除,这使得动态网站的数据管理变得简单快捷。

4、安全性考虑

防止SQL注入:在执行用户输入的SQL指令之前,应始终使用PHP的mysqli_real_escape_string()函数或PDO的参数绑定功能进行过滤和处理,以防止SQL注入攻击。

合理设置权限:数据库账户应遵循最小权限原则,仅授予必要的权限,以减少潜在的安全风险。

5、性能优化

使用索引:合理使用索引可以显著提高查询速度,特别是在处理大量数据时。

分页处理:在显示大量数据时,使用分页技术可以减少单次加载的数据量,提高页面加载速度和用户体验。

在了解以上内容后,以下还有一些其他建议:

定期备份数据:以防数据丢失或损坏,应定期备份数据库。

监控数据库性能:使用工具如MySQL Workbench监控数据库运行状态,及时发现并解决可能的性能问题。

结合PHP和MySQL不仅可以有效地管理和展示数据库中的数据,还可以通过各种安全和优化措施确保网站的稳定运行和数据的安全,对于动态网站开发而言,掌握这些技术是基本而必要的。

0